设计模式: 单件(singleton)模式(2015-04-29 11:46)
2015-05-19 15:12
253 查看
1, 定义:
确保一个类只有一个实例,并提供一个全局访问点
2,类图
![](http://img.blog.csdn.net/20150519151243826?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Qvd2xxaW5nd2Vp/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
3,优点:
提供全局的一个实例;
延迟实例化;(当然也可以在static变量定义的同时创建Singleton的实例)
确保一个类只有一个实例,并提供一个全局访问点
2,类图
3,优点:
提供全局的一个实例;
延迟实例化;(当然也可以在static变量定义的同时创建Singleton的实例)
相关文章推荐
- 设计模式--单件模式(Singleton)
- 设计模式之——单件模式(Singleton)
- 魔兽争霸之PHP设计模式-单件模式[Singleton]
- 设计模式之单件模式(Singleton)
- C#设计模式系列:单件模式(Singleton)
- C++设计模式之Singleton(单件/单例)模式
- 设计模式(五):创建型模式—Singleton(单件)
- 设计模式 单件模式(Singleton)
- 设计模式学习笔记(二)——Singleton单件模式
- 设计模式之单件(Singleton)的应用
- java设计模式之单件模式Singleton
- 【设计模式基础】创建型模式 - 1 - 单件(Singleton)
- 设计模式(五)[单件(Singleton)模式]
- 设计模式--创建型-SINGLETON(单件)
- 一起谈.NET技术,C#面向对象设计模式纵横谈:Singleton 单件
- 设计模式之单件模式 singleton
- 设计模式单件(Singleton)---对象创建型模式
- 设计模式系列之(一)-------------------单件模式(Singleton)
- [导入]C#面向对象设计模式纵横谈(2):Singleton 单件(创建型模式).zip(9.57 MB)
- 设计模式-单件模式(Singleton)